An emergency situation occurred in the Amur Region of Russia - a Robinson R66 helicopter with three people on board went missing. This was reported by the Russian propaganda media TASS, citing the press service of the EMERCOM Main Directorate.
According to the agency, on September 16, the helicopter's emergency beacon activated while it was conducting an unregistered flight over the territory of the Zeysky municipal district.
Currently, two ground teams, including eight people and two pieces of equipment, are involved in the search. As of the morning of September 17, search operations are ongoing.
